What we're looking for:

  • College students in Construction Management, Environmental Science, Environmental Engineering, or a related field.
  • Interns are required to work 40+ hour weeks, preferable when the student is taking a semester away from school.
  • Proficiency in computer skills, including Microsoft Office, Bluebeam, Outlook, Smart Devices, Dropbox, etc.
  • Strong organizational skills are essential to handle a variety of tasks effectively.
  • A degree of travel is required for the internship.

Co-op/Intern is responsible for and will learn various job site functions including, but not limited to:

  • Soliciting quotes from subcontractors and suppliers for equipment, materials, and services.
  • Communicate with subcontractors and vendors to clarify scope, schedule, and pricing.
  • Support development of work plans, schedules, and sequencing for complex projects.
  • Perform quantity takeoffs for materials.
  • Attend site visits and document site conditions.
  • Assist in building cost estimates.
  • Track addenda, clarifications, and scope changes during the bid process
  • Help prepare bid packages and assist with submissions.
